Air museum’s historic resource

Launched in 1986, the air museum is a “significant historic depository honoring the guys, women of all ages, and machines that have impacted the wealthy record of aviation. By way of displays and activities that encourage, educate, and entertain, the museum has develop into a practical and crucial historic resource for our location and the state of North Dakota” in accordance to its heritage.

Among the quite a few characteristics of the air museum includes one particular of the major displays of Planet War II-period plane in the Midwest.

The air museum’s schooling options consist of giving aviation camps for university little ones, faculty tours, and aviation schooling scholarships.

Don Larson is president of the air museum board of administrators. Jenna Grindberg is the museum director.

The air museum is located at 100 34th Avenue NE near Minot International Airport.
